{"id":7902,"date":"2026-04-13T09:56:40","date_gmt":"2026-04-13T04:26:40","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/qloudhost.com\/blog\/?p=7902"},"modified":"2026-04-13T10:01:41","modified_gmt":"2026-04-13T04:31:41","slug":"nextcloud-vs-owncloud","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/qloudhost.com\/blog\/nextcloud-vs-owncloud","title":{"rendered":"Nextcloud vs ownCloud In 2026: Best Complete Comparison"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Nextcloud vs ownCloud in 2026 comes down to collaboration depth versus raw file-serving performance. Nextcloud offers an all-in-one collaboration hub with robust apps, while ownCloud focuses on a streamlined, high-speed file platform, especially with its modern \u201cInfinite Scale\u201d stack.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Both are secure and enterprise-ready. Choose by your team workflow, compliance needs, and scale. In this section, we\u2019ll look at how both platforms handle performance under real-world usage and which one feels more reliable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"core-stacks-and-what-they-mean\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Core Stacks and What They Mean<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div id=\"affiliate-style-076f9367-dfa5-4304-8839-d7930825402b\" class=\"wp-block-affiliate-booster-ab-icon-list affiliate-block-076f93 affiliate-iconlist-wrapper\"><div class=\"affiliate-iconlist-inner aff-list-isshow-icon\"><div class=\"affiliate-block-advanced-list affiliate-icon-list affiliate-alignment-left\"><ul class=\"affiliate-list affiliate-list-type-unordered affiliate-list-bullet-arrow-alt-circle-right\"><li><strong>Nextcloud (PHP stack)<\/strong><br>-> Best paired with Nginx or Apache, PHP-FPM, Redis (file locking + caching), and PostgreSQL (for large instances).<br>-> Performance scales well with NVMe storage, tuned OPCache, and object storage for cold data.<\/li><li><strong>ownCloud Infinite Scale (Go, microservices)<\/strong><br>-> Concurrency-friendly design, lightweight services, and efficient memory usage.<br>-> Object storage-first; ideal for S3-compatible backends and multi-petabyte datasets.<\/li><\/ul><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"scaling-and-storage-backends\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Scaling and Storage Backends<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div id=\"affiliate-style-7c1d7657-55eb-494e-a725-4c56ce7ba305\" class=\"wp-block-affiliate-booster-ab-icon-list affiliate-block-7c1d76 affiliate-iconlist-wrapper\"><div class=\"affiliate-iconlist-inner aff-list-isshow-icon\"><div class=\"affiliate-block-advanced-list affiliate-icon-list affiliate-alignment-left\"><ul class=\"affiliate-list affiliate-list-type-unordered affiliate-list-bullet-arrow-alt-circle-right\"><li>Both support local POSIX storage; <strong>ownCloud Infinite Scale<\/strong> shines with S3 and large-object workloads.<\/li><li><strong>Nextcloud<\/strong> works well with primary NVMe and external storages (S3, SMB, NFS) using the External Storage app\u2014great for tiered storage strategies.<\/li><li>For millions of files, plan for database indexes, Redis locks, and dedicated metadata nodes (where applicable).<\/li><\/ul><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 id=\"client-performance-and-virtual-files\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Client Performance and Virtual Files<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div id=\"affiliate-style-a0ce7216-cf16-4c30-99d0-40ef204c65ba\" class=\"wp-block-affiliate-booster-ab-icon-list affiliate-block-a0ce72 affiliate-iconlist-wrapper\"><div class=\"affiliate-iconlist-inner aff-list-isshow-icon\"><div class=\"affiliate-block-advanced-list affiliate-icon-list affiliate-alignment-left\"><ul class=\"affiliate-list affiliate-list-type-unordered affiliate-list-bullet-arrow-alt-circle-right\"><li>Both platforms offer Windows\/macOS\/Linux clients and mobile apps with selective sync and \u201cvirtual files\u201d modes to save disk space.<\/li><li>Bandwidth shaping, chunked uploads, and parallel transfers help on high-latency links.<\/li><li>For Windows fleets, deploy via GPO with preconfigured policies for consistent user experience.<\/li><\/ul><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ity is-style-wide\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"practical-tuning-checklist-what-i-configure-on-day-1\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Practical Tuning Checklist (What I Configure on Day 1)<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Before you start using Nextcloud or ownCloud in production, a few basic optimizations can save you from future performance and stability issues. Here\u2019s the exact checklist I usually follow on day one to keep everything running smooth and reliable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div id=\"affiliate-style-9d26bb03-dd01-49af-a7c1-5c651dbbc28f\" class=\"wp-block-affiliate-booster-ab-icon-list affiliate-block-9d26bb affiliate-iconlist-wrapper\"><div class=\"affiliate-iconlist-inner aff-list-isshow-icon\"><div class=\"affiliate-block-advanced-list affiliate-icon-list affiliate-alignment-left\"><ul class=\"affiliate-list affiliate-list-type-unordered affiliate-list-bullet-arrow-alt-circle-right\"><li>Redis for locking, APCu for local cache (Nextcloud\/ownCloud PHP editions).<\/li><li>PostgreSQL with tuned work_mem, shared_buffers; separate DB volume on NVMe.<\/li><li>Nginx with HTTP\/2, brotli\/gzip; keep-alive and buffering tuned for large uploads.<\/li><li>OPcache JIT disabled for stability; adequate opcache.memory_consumption.<\/li><li>Background jobs via system cron (not AJAX); queue workers for heavy tasks.<\/li><li>Object storage for archives; NVMe for hot datasets and metadata.<\/li><li>CDN or edge caching for public downloads; WAF plus geo\/IP controls.<\/li><\/ul><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code has-vce-bg-color has-vce-meta-background-color has-text-color has-background has-link-color wp-elements-9daadcb188475e33ee427ba978220fd0\"><code># Example Nginx, PHP-FPM, and Redis tuning snippets (adjust to your environment)\n# Nginx: large file uploads and caching\nclient_max_body_size 20G;\nproxy_request_buffering off;\nsendfile on;\ntcp_nopush on;\ntcp_nodelay on;\nkeepalive_timeout 65;\n# Gzip\/Brotli as supported\n\n# PHP-FPM (www.conf)\npm = dynamic\npm.max_children = 50\npm.max_requests = 500\nphp_admin_value&#91;opcache.enable]=1\nphp_admin_value&#91;opcache.memory_consumption]=256\n\n# Redis (redis.conf)\nmaxmemory 2gb\nmaxmemory-policy allkeys-lru\nappendonly yes\n<\/code><\/pre>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ity is-style-wide\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"security-and-compliance\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Security and Compliance<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When it comes to cloud storage, security and compliance are often the biggest deciding factors for users and businesses alike. If you need help planning, sizing, or hosting, QloudHost\u2019s experts can guide you end to end.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ity is-style-wide\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h2 id=\"faqs-nextcloud-vs-owncloud-2026\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>FAQs: Nextcloud vs ownCloud 2026<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n<div id=\"rank-math-faq\" class=\"rank-math-block\">\n<div class=\"rank-math-list \">\n<div id=\"faq-question-1765787464770\" class=\"rank-math-list-item\">\n<h3 id=\"is-nextcloud-more-secure-than-owncloud\" class=\"rank-math-question \"><strong>Is Nextcloud more secure than ownCloud?<\/strong><\/h3>\n<div class=\"rank-math-answer \">\n\n<p>Both are highly secure when configured correctly. Each supports SSO\/SAML, MFA, server-side encryption, auditing, antivirus, and access controls. Real-world security depends on your policies: hardened TLS, strong identity, least-privilege shares, and a solid patching cadence. Choose based on feature fit and your ability to operate it securely.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div id=\"faq-question-1765787467960\" class=\"rank-math-list-item\">\n<h3 id=\"which-is-faster-nextcloud-or-owncloud\" class=\"rank-math-question \"><strong>Which is faster: Nextcloud or ownCloud?<\/strong><\/h3>\n<div class=\"rank-math-answer \">\n\n<p>For large, object storage-heavy deployments, ownCloud\u2019s Infinite Scale architecture typically delivers higher throughput and concurrency. Nextcloud performs excellently with NVMe, Redis, and a tuned database. Benchmark your specific workloads (small files vs large media, many concurrent users) before deciding.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div id=\"faq-question-1765787469496\" class=\"rank-math-list-item\">\n<h3 id=\"does-nextcloud-or-owncloud-have-end-to-end-encryption\" class=\"rank-math-question \"><strong>Does Nextcloud or ownCloud have end-to-end encryption?<\/strong><\/h3>\n<div class=\"rank-math-answer \">\n\n<p>Both offer folder-level end-to-end encryption. It\u2019s best for highly sensitive data but can limit certain server-side features (like web-based editing) on encrypted items. Many organizations use E2EE selectively, combining it with server-side encryption and strict access controls elsewhere.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div id=\"faq-question-1765787471945\" class=\"rank-math-list-item\">\n<h3 id=\"can-i-self-host-on-a-low-power-device-e-g-raspberry-pi\" class=\"rank-math-question \"><strong>Can I self-host on a low-power device (e.g., Raspberry Pi)?<\/strong><\/h3>\n<div class=\"rank-math-answer \">\n\n<p>You can run lightweight home or lab instances on a Raspberry Pi, but expect constraints with indexing, previews, and database performance.
